Cytomegalovirus (CMV), a prevalent DNA virus, often infects humans globally. Though generally asymptomatic, CMV can pose grave health risks to immunocompromised individuals, such as those with HIV/AIDS cytomegalovirus infection or undergoing organ transfers.{Infection occurs through saliva, blood, urine, and other bodily fluids. Symptoms of CMV infection can range from mild flu-like symptoms to severe complications, including encephalitis. A vaccine against CMV is currently under development, but no effective cure exists. Management of CMV infection often involves antiviral medications and monitoring for potential complications.
- Identifying CMV typically involves blood tests to detect antibodies or viral DNA.
- Avoiding CMV spread includes practicing good hygiene, avoiding contact with infected individuals' bodily fluids, and using protective equipment during medical procedures.

Detection and Handling of CMV Infections
Diagnosing cytomegalovirus (CMV) infections often involves a combination of clinical evaluation and laboratory testing. A healthcare provider will first assess the patient's symptoms and medical history to determine if CMV infection is a likely possibility. Laboratory tests, such as blood tests to detect CMV antibodies or viral DNA in the urine, can confirm the diagnosis.
Once diagnosed, CMV infections are typically handled based on the severity of the infection and the patient's individual situation. For mildly symptomatic individuals, supportive care measures may be sufficient. These measures include sleep, adequate hydration, and pain relief as needed.
In cases of serious CMV infections, antiviral medications are often prescribed to suppress viral replication. These medications can help mitigate symptoms and prevent complications. The specific type and duration of treatment will vary depending on the patient's condition.
It is important for individuals with CMV infections to maintain good hygiene practices, such as frequent handwashing, to reduce the risk of transmission to others. Pregnant women should inform their healthcare providers about any potential exposure to CMV, as infection during pregnancy can have severe consequences for the fetus.

Impact of Immune System in Controlling CMV Infections
Cytomegalovirus (CMV) is a widespread pathogen that can cause mild illness, particularly in individuals with weakened immune systems. The human immune system plays a essential role in controlling CMV spread. Upon initial infection, the primary immune response acts to contain viral growth.
This is followed by a adaptive immune response characterized by the generation of antibodies and CD8+ T cells that can directly eliminate target cells.
However, CMV has evolved advanced mechanisms to escape immune detection. This allows the virus to establish a lifelong persistent infection within the body.
Understanding the interplay between CMV and the immune response is crucial for developing effective treatments and preventive measures.
